One of the most critical features is temperature control. As noted by sommelier Lucy Canfield, "Maintaining a consistent temperature is essential for preserving the quality of wine." Look for wine coolers with dual-zone cooling systems if you plan to store different types of wine. This allows you to store red and white wines at their optimal temperatures simultaneously.
Capacity is another important consideration. Wine connoisseur Marco Reyes emphasizes, "Choosing a cooler that fits your collection is vital. Overcrowding can lead to undesired temperature fluctuations." When assessing capacity, think about both your current wine collection and future purchases. The noise level of a wine cooler is also worth considering, especially if it will be placed in a living area. According to appliance expert John Faxon, "A quiet operation ensures that the ambiance of your space is maintained." Models with compressor cooling tend to be louder than thermoelectric ones, so be sure to check specifications if noise is a concern.
